What is the interface of MAIN?

main and aux are the main antenna interface and auxiliary antenna interface respectively.

The wiring conditions of the two interfaces main and aux of the laptop's built-in wireless network card are as follows:


1. Main is the main antenna, usually gray, and aux is the auxiliary antenna, usually gray. It is black;


2. Most Intel wireless network card motherboards only have numbers 1, 2, and 3. The main number identified is 1 (connected to the gray line), and the aux number is 2 (connected to the black line). , if there are 3, usually connect the white line. For some M.2 interface network cards, the main number is 2 and the aux number is 1;


#3. The antenna is usually installed by the manufacturer. Please contact the manufacturer for after-sales verification.

Wireless network card is a terminal wireless network device. It is a terminal that uses wireless signals for data transmission without wired connection. Depending on the interface, wireless network cards mainly include PCMCIA wireless network cards, PCI wireless network cards, MiniPCI wireless network cards, USB wireless network cards, and CF/SD wireless network cards.

The role and function of a wireless network card are the same as those of an ordinary computer network card. It is used to connect to a local area network. It is just a device that sends and receives signals. It can only be connected to the Internet when it finds an exit to the Internet. All wireless network cards can only be limited to areas where wireless LANs have been deployed. A wireless network card is a network card that uses wireless signals to connect without a wired connection. The mainstream application of wireless networks is divided into two methods: GPRS mobile phone wireless network Internet access and wireless LAN.
